Enterobacteriaceae Part 1

  • 1

    Facultatively anaerobic, non-spore-forming, Gram-negative bacilli

    Enterobacteriaciae

  • 2

    All members of the Family Enterobacteriaceae are motile at 35 degree cent. with peritrichous flagella except for ________, __________ and __________.

    Klebsiella, Shigella and Yersinia

  • 3

    All members of the Family Enterobacteriaceae are _____________ except for Klebsiella and Enterobacter

    non-encapsulated

  • 4

    True/False: All members of the Family Enterobacteriaceae ferment glucose and reduce nitrate to nitrite.

    True

  • 5

    Most of the members of the Family Enterobacteriaceae are present in the Intestinal tract as commensal microbiota except for:

    Plesiomonas, Salmonella, Shigella, and Yersinia

  • 6

    They may grow at 1 to 5 degree cent.

    Serratia and Yersinia

  • 7

    Describe the appearance of Enterobacteriaceae under the microscope

    Gram-negative rods or coccobacilli with rounded ends

  • 8

    All members of the Family Enterobacteriaceae are Catalase (+) and Oxidase (-) except for _______________________.

    Plesiomonas shigelloides

  • 9

    Common genera in the Family Enterobacteriaceae

    Citrobacter Enterobacter Escherichia Klebsiella Morganella Pantoea Proteus Providencia Salmonella Serratia Shigella Yersinia Plesiomonas

  • 10

    What are the two groups of Enterobacteria?

    Oppurtunistic pathogens Overt/True pathogens

  • 11

    They are part of the intestinal microbiota of both humans and animals and generally do not initiate disease in healthy, uncompromised human hosts. But they produce significant virulent factors.

    Opportunistic pathogens

  • 12

    Give examples of Opportunistic pathogens

    Escherichia coli Citrobacter Enterobacter Klebsiella Proteus Serratia

  • 13

    They are present as commensal microbiota of the human GIT and are acquired through ingestion of contaminated food or water. Their presence in specimens is considered as very significant.

    Overt/ True pathogens

  • 14

    Give examples of Overt/ True pathogens

    Salmonella Shigella Yersinia pestis

  • 15

    They are ESBL - producing enterobacteria

    Escherichia coli Klebsiella pneumoniae Klebsiella oxytoca

  • 16

    They are isolated from the urinary tract and can cause bacteremia

    Escherichia coli Klebsiella pneumoniae Proteus mirabilis

  • 17

    They are antibiotic-resistant genera

    Citrobacter Enterobacter Serratia

  • 18

    They are associated with diarrhoea

    Shigella Salmonella Escherichia coli Yersinia

  • 19

    What are the antigen-determinants for Serological Identification of Enterobacteria?

    Somatic O antigen Flagellar H antigen Capsular K antigen

  • 20

    Heat stable; located in the cell wall; used for E. coli and Shigella serotyping.

    Somatic O antigen

  • 21

    Heat labile; found in the flagellum; used for Salmonella serotyping.

    Flagellar H antigen

  • 22

    Heat labile; polysaccharide; found as K1 antigen of E. coli and Vi antigen of Salmonella enterica serotype Typhi.

    Capsular K antigen

  • 23

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Escherichia coli

    Bacteriuria Septicemia Neonatal sepsis Meningitis Diarrheal syndrome

  • 24

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Shigella

    Diarrhea Dysentery

  • 25

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Edwardsiella

    Diarrhea Wound infection Septicemia Meningitis Enteric fever

  • 26

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Salmonella

    Septicemia Enteric fever Diarrhea

  • 27

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Citrobacter

    Opportunistic and Nosocomial infections

  • 28

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Klebsiella

    Bacteriuria Pneumonia Septicemia

  • 29

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Morganella

    Opportunistic and Nosocomial infections

  • 30

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Enterobacter, Serratia, Proteus and Providencia

    Opportunistic and Nosocomial infections Wound infections Bacteriuria Septicemia

  • 31

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Yersinia pestis

    Plague

  • 32

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Yersinia pseudotuberculosis and Yersinia enterolitica

    Mesenteric adenitis Diarrhea

  • 33

    Associated Infections/Diseases with Erwinia

    Wound that are contaminated with soil

  • 34

    It is also known as Colon bacillus

    Escherichia coli

  • 35

    It is the most significant species in the genus Escherichia

    Escherichia coli

  • 36

    Escherichia coli -Most significant species in the genus Escherichia -It has the _________ and _____________.

    Sex pili adhesive fimbriae

  • 37

    Describe Escherichia coli in MAC

    Colonies appear flat and dry, and exhibit a pink color (lactose fermenter or LF); some strains may be non-lactose fermenters or NLF.

  • 38

    Describe Escherichia coli in BAP

    Most strains are non- haemolytic; some strains are β-haemolytic

  • 39

    Describe Escherichia coli in EMB

    Exhibits a greenish metallic sheen

  • 40

    What are the Virulence factors of Escherichia coli?

    Endotoxin Common pili Kl antigen Intimin

  • 41

    What are the antigenic determinants of Escherichia coli?

    O antigens H antigens K antigens

  • 42

    What does IMViC stands for?

    (Indole, methyl red, Voges-Proskauer and citrate)

  • 43

    What are the Biochemical test done in Escherichia coli?

    IMViC TSIA reaction

  • 44

    What is the result for TSIA reaction of Escherichia coli?

    A/A ( acidic slant/acidic butt), (+) gas, (-) H2S

  • 45

    It is formerly called E. coli atypical or enteric group H and has been isolated from CSF, wounds, and blood.

    Escherichia hermanii

  • 46

    What is the appearance of Escherichia hermanii in Culture?

    Have yellow pigmentation

  • 47

    Enterotoxigenic E. coli only grows on ______.

    BAP

  • 48

    Verotoxin I is similar to the __________ that is produced by Shigella dysenteriae 1.

    Shiga toxin

  • 49

    _________ causes damage to the kidney (Vero) cells of the African green monkey.

    Verotoxin

  • 50

    They are usually found in the GIT of humans and animals. And colonies exhibit pink color in MAC.

    Klebsiella

  • 51

    Give atleast two species of Klebsiella

    Klebsiella pneumonia subsp.pneumonia Klebsiella oxytoca Klebsiella pneumonia subsp. ozaenae Klebsiella pneumonia subsp. rhinoscleromatis Klebsiella ornithinolytica

  • 52

    Describe the appearance of Klebsiella in MAC

    Colonies exhibits a pink color

  • 53

    What is the other name for Klebsiella pneumonia subsp.pneumoniae?

    Friedlander's bacillus

  • 54

    What is the virulence factor of Klebsiella pneumonia subsp.pneumoniae?

    Polysaccharide capsule

  • 55

    Most commonly isolated species of Klebsiella( answer with its other name)

    Friedlander's bacillus

  • 56

    Causative agent of a community-acquired pneumonia, afflicted patients cough up a “ currant jelly-like” sputum.

    Klebsiella pneumonia subs.pneumoniae

  • 57

    Describe the appearance of Klebsiella pneumonia subsp.pneumoniae in MAC

    Colonies exhibit a pink color and are mucoid ( LF)

  • 58

    What is the differential test for Klebsiella pneumonia subs.pneumoniae?

    (+) string test

  • 59

    Result of Neufeld- Quellung test for Klebsiella pneumonia subs.pneumoniae

    Positive

  • 60

    Result of Growth on media with potassium cyanide (KCN) for Klebsiella pneumonia subs.pneumoniae

    Positive

  • 61

    Result of IMViC reaction for Klebsiella pneumonia subs.pneumoniae

    --++

  • 62

    Result of TSIA reaction for Klebsiella pneumonia subs.pneumoniae

    A/A, (+) gas (-)H2S

  • 63

    What species of Klebsiella are Indole positive?

    Klebsiella oxytoca Klebsiella ornithinolytica

  • 64

    This specie of Klebsiella causes a granuloma of the nose and oropharynx.

    Klebsiella pneumonia subsp. rhinoscleromatis

  • 65

    This specie of Klebsiella is the causative agent of chronic atrophic rhinitis which is also known as the “foul-smelling” atrophic rhinitis

    Klebsiella pneumonia subsp. ozaenae

  • 66

    What are the differential tests for commonly isolated Klebsiella species?

    Indole Methyl red Urease Lysine decarboxylase Gelatin liquefaction(LDC) Growth in KCN Alginate utilization

  • 67

    Resemble those of Klebsiella when grown on a MacConkey agar.

    Enterobacter

  • 68

    Describe Enterobacter in MAC

    Colonies exhibit color and are sometimes mucoid(LF)

  • 69

    What are the common isolates of Enterobacter?

    Enterobacter aerogenes Enterobacter cloacae

  • 70

    What are the significant species of the genus Enterobacter?

    Enterobacter aerogenes Enterobacter cloacae Enterobacter gergoviae Enterobacter bormaechei

  • 71

    What are the Biochemical test for Enterobacter?

    Ornithine decarboxylase test Lysine decarboxylase(LDC) test Sorbitol fermentation Urease test Malonate test IMViC reaction TSIA reaction

  • 72

    This specie of Enterobacter is found in respiratory samples and is rarely isolated from blood cultures.

    Enterobacter gergoviae

  • 73

    This specie of Enterobacter is isolated with osteomyelitis following traumatic wounds

    Enterobacter cancerogenus (formerly Enterobacter taylorae)

  • 74

    What are the differential tests for commonly isolated Enterobacter species?

    Lysine decarboxylase Arginine dihydrolase Ornithine decarboxylase Urease Alginate utilization

  • 75

    Formerly known as Enterobacter sakazakii

    Cronobacter sakazakii

  • 76

    -Found as contaminants of powdered infant formula -This is isolated from individuals with brain abscesses, and respiratory and wound infections.

    Cronobacter

  • 77

    What are the media used in the culture of Cronobacter sakazakii?

    MAC BHIA

  • 78

    Formerly known as Enterobacter agglomerans

    Pantoea agglomerans

  • 79

    It causes nosocomial outbreaks of septicaemia due to contamination of IV Fluids

    Pantoea

  • 80

    What is the result of the IMViC reaction for Pantoea?

    -v+v

  • 81

    What is the result of the TSIA reaction for Pantoea?

    K/A ( Alkaline slant/ Acidic butt), (-) gas, (-) H2S

  • 82

    -Opportunistic pathogens that are usually associated with nosocomial outbreaks -Resistant to a wide range of antibiotics

    Serratia

  • 83

    Describe the appearance of Serratia in MAC

    Colonies are clear and colorless (NLF); some strains may show slow or late lactose fermentation.

  • 84

    What are the Biochemical test(+) for Serratia?

    Dnase Gelatinase Lipase ONPG

  • 85

    What are the diff species of the genus Serratia?

    Serratia marcescens Serratia odorifera Serratia rubidaea Serratia liquefaciens Serratia plymuthica

  • 86

    What is the result of TSIA reaction for Serratia?

    K/A, (+) gas,(-) H2S

  • 87

    What is the result of the IMViC reaction for Serratia?

    --++

  • 88

    These species of Serratia produces pink to red colonies ( due to the production of prodigiosin pigments) after incubation at 25 degree cent.

    Serratia marcescens Serratia rubidaea Serratia liquifaciens Serratia plymuthica

  • 89

    This specie of Serratia has a musty and pungent odor or a “rotten potato-like” odor

    Serratia odorifera

  • 90

    This specie of Serratia ferments arabinose and exhibits growth in a culture medium with KCN

    Serratia liquefaciens

  • 91

    Five major categories of diarrheagenic E. coli

    Enterotoxigenic Escherichia coli (ETEC) Enteroinvasive Escherichia coli (EIEC) Enteropathogenic Escherichia coli (EPEC) Enterohemorrhagic Escherichia coli (EHEC) Enteroadherent Escherichia coli (EAEC)
